Output 12a78d34e8dec45d918ae32336dd07fa76839c8a7e70efeee65658cc2e9fda7f:1

value
2140168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83e8fe7b606767391226d2bbcbe4e935b40aff1 OP_EQUAL
address
3MQQpsXvuwoZnzpHar1Cad8sdPyZEzXYSY
transaction
12a78d34e8dec45d918ae32336dd07fa76839c8a7e70efeee65658cc2e9fda7f
spent
true